Spurs fans in for a treat


ProEvents Management Limited CEO Julian Kam (right) and ProEvents International Sdn Bhd managing director San Boon Wah (left) presenting the tickets to Star Media Group managing director and chief executive officer Datuk Seri Wong Chun Wai.

PETALING JAYA: Football fans are in for a treat with the upcoming Tottenham Hotspur AIA Cup Asia Tour, jointly organised by The Star and ProEvents International.

The media partnership will give readers a chance to get hold of tickets in giveaways in the coming weeks for the match on May 27 at Shah Alam Stadium.
